Job description

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ES


Following is a summary of the essential functions for this job. Other duties may be performed, both major and minor, which are not mentioned below. Specific activities may change from time to time.

1. Effectively develop and partner with Category Managers/Directors to implement category strategies with medium/high spend levels, complexity, and strategic importance within his/her portfolio to optimize business efficiency and drive maximum value.
2. Develops an understanding of the current category activity within Truist and determines where SSM can have a greater involvement and drive value. Specializes by developing deep expertise within the category(s). Maintains deep understanding of global supply markets, competitors and product innovations.
3. Builds strong relationships with ‘internal customers’ and industry suppliers. Partners with Business Leaders and Executives to ensure that sourcing strategies/category plans and execution are aligned with the Business and MoE/ecosystem Goals.
4. Leads cross functional teams in the development of category specifications, RFIs, RFPs, contracts, and sourcing project plans.
5. Performs market data analysis for negotiations and supplier selection, and leads high-complexity sourcing events. Compiles commodity profile details such as supplier performance, volume forecasts, and design specifications. Analyzes trends and dynamics of supply markets, and prepares commodity-specific performance metrics & dashboards.
6. Ensures that best practices in the sourcing process are followed. Execute the full sourcing process which includes development of scope, supplier selection, commercial negotiation, third party risk acceptance and contract execution. Engages risk stakeholders as needed for sourcing activity.
7. Drive to remedy inconsistent vendor performance across the enterprise and improve vendor performance/optimizing allocation of spend.

10. Actively manage pipeline of projects for team and ensure project delivery to agreed upon timelines and expectations.
11. Participates in special projects and performs other duties as assigned.


QUALIFICATIONS
Required Qualifications:

The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

1. A Bachelor’s degree is required
2. 6 to 10 years of relevant experience in sourcing (and related functions) with regulated organizations known for the strength of their operational, customer service, and risk excellence.
3. Knowledge of the market, suppliers and cost drivers. Demonstrated experience with managing matrixed supplier relationships
4. Direct management experience of a sourcing/procurement team function with strategic development responsibilities in Financial Services and/or heavily regulated industry
5. Ability to learn content quickly and apply a strategic lens to category spend
6. Ability to engage and communication with internal and external stakeholders
7. Track record of success in supplier consolidation and driving spend to preferred suppliers
8. Subject Matter Expertise in strategic sourcing methodology and techniques
9. Demonstrated ability to develop client relationships
10. Proficient analytical skills
11. Proficient written and verbal communication skills
12. Proficient project management and time management skills
13. Proficient business acumen
14. Proficient negotiation and influencing skills
15. Proficient interpersonal skills with the ability to communicate effectively at all levels, particularly at the management level
16. Self-motivated, with executive presence and presentation skills

Preferred Qualifications:
1. An MBA, Masters in Supply Chain and industry certifications are preferred
2. Ideally, this experience should be broad based involving several of the following functions: procurement, sourcing and third party management

The annual base salary for this position is $116,500 - $160,000

General Description of Available Benefits for Eligible Employees of Truist Financial Corporation: All regular teammates (not temporary or contingent workers) working 20 hours or more per week are eligible for benefits, though eligibility for specific benefits may be determined by the division of Truist offering the position. Truist offers medical, dental, vision, life insurance, disability, accidental death and dismemberment, tax-preferred savings accounts, and a 401k plan to teammates. Teammates also receive no less than 10 days of vacation (prorated based on date of hire and by full-time or part-time status) during their first year of employment, along with 10 sick days (also prorated), and paid holidays.
